Abstract

The utility model discloses a kind of cage lifter control system, comprise the infrared induction system being realized slitless connection by relay programmable module and elevator door-motor system, realized the speech control system of slitless connection by speech control module and the original floor selective system of elevator, and realized the command and control system of slitless connection by elevator remote-control module and elevator lifting system.The utility model adopts infrared induction technology, and user only need slightly stop by the automatic induction zone before elevator door, and elevator door can be opened automatically, without the need to manual control.

Detailed description of the invention
Shown in Fig. 1, relate to a kind of cage lifter control system, comprise the infrared induction system being realized slitless connection by relay programmable module and elevator door-motor system, realized the speech control system of slitless connection by speech control module and the original floor selective system of elevator, and realized the command and control system of slitless connection by elevator remote-control module and elevator lifting system.
Visible in Fig. 2, described infrared induction system comprises the infrared inductor be arranged in the middle of elevator door pocket, and it is for receiving the infrared signal of induction zone, and sends to described relay programmable module to carry out identifying and judging, and controls the opening and closing of elevator door.Concrete, infrared inductor is installed on position, elevator head trim middle, and the induction angular range of general infrared inductor is 140 °, and the width of common buildings passage can not more than 2 meters.
According to Fig. 2, suppose x=2m × tan70 °=2.4m, it can thus be appreciated that the extreme length in infrared induction district is 4.8 meters.Normally people's speed of travel is 4.3km/h=4300 ÷ 3600m/s=1.19m/s, calculates by this speed, and people is normally walked and can not to be exceeded by the time of induction zone: 4.8m ÷ 1.19m/s=4s.
Infrared induction working-flow is as shown in Figure 3: passerby passes by induction zone and user rests on induction zone, and infrared inductor all can receive signal, and signal 1 and signal 2 can be distinguished by time length.Calculate every signal time and just can judge that user rests on induction zone to want to take elevator according to above more than 5s, and signal time is less than 5s and just can judges just have passerby to pass by elevator.Relay programmable module receives signal duration more than 5s, relay closes, and trigger elevator door-motor system, elevator door is opened; Relay programmable module receives signal duration and is less than 5s, and relay does not close, and cannot trigger elevator door-motor system, elevator door is reactionless.
Wherein, speech control system of the present utility model comprises: be arranged at elevator door dual-side joint for starting the contact switch of speech control system.As shown in Figure 4, when elevator door is shut in a flash, contact switch closes, speech control system starts, elevator floor voice control system can be triggered start working, until receive 2 useful signals or elevator door close after more than 20 seconds (based on first comer), elevator floor voice control system quits work.
Speech control system principle of work as shown in Figure 5.The realization of speech control system function mainly adopts existing speech recognition system and is corrected.The groundwork of this system divides 2 stages.1. the voice training stage: the task of this one-phase mainly builds sound bank.Gather the sample sound (vocabulary that reading is specified: 1st floor, 2nd floors, 3rd floors about 50 people ...) be burnt on writing card.2. speech recognition period: the task of this one-phase mainly gathers voice signal, extract principal character by the voice comparison in itself and sound bank, what mate most is exactly recognition result.
Speech control system cardinal principle as shown in Figure 5.1. acquisition of signal: the various sound exceeding certain decibel in main collection elevator.2. extract principal character: screened by all aud. snl.s collected, filter out the voice containing 1st floor, 2nd floors, 3rd floors etc.3. with sound bank proportioning (identification): by the voice proportioning of storing in the voice filtered out and sound bank, find out the voice mated most and be recognition result.4. decision-making: according to recognition result, assigns instruction to elevator controlling control system, thus corresponding floor gone to by control elevator; Play voice message by loudspeaker: " good, I will be with you to * building " simultaneously.
In addition, command and control system of the present utility model comprises remote controller, for receiving the signal of remote controller and triggering the elevator remote-control module of elevator lifting system works, and by elevator remote-control module just car arriving signal feed back to the car detecting sensor of remote controller.
The workflow of above-mentioned command and control system as shown in Figure 6.Before user gos out and takes elevator, elevator can be called out by home used remote controler operating in a key, automatically elevator lifting system can be triggered after elevator remote-control module receives the transmission signal of remote controller, and after elevator arrival, arriving signal can be fed back to remote controller to realize the object of reminding user by car detecting sensor.In order to prevent, in elevator lifting process, arriving signal being fed back to all the other floors, set up the mobilizing function of elevator remote-control module to car detecting sensor.The car detecting sensor that the remote controller only having certain hour interior (different floor can set different time) just to call out is corresponding just can be activated, and the car detecting sensor that other floor numbers do not called out are corresponding is in dormant state.
